Hi Saymon,

For the stage you are at the boot loader should be loaded and having the screen black is expected. You should be able to connect to the device from your PC in fastboot mode. When you use the command "fastboot devices" is the device showing up in the list? If so then you are connected and should be able to proceed.

I have found an issue with the mc32_flash.bat file which would cause the fastboot commands to fail. This has been corrected and I have uploaded a new OS conversion package (with updated instructions). Please download this package to continue with update process.

Assuming that with your device in its present state you can connect to it with fastboot then you can proceed with the conversion process from the section "Flashing Android OS to MC32" in the instruction document.
